>>> 2787../hw/vfio/common.c: In function ‘vfio_listener_log_global_start’:
>>> 2788../hw/vfio/common.c:1772:8: error: ‘ret’ may be used uninitialized in this function [-Werror=maybe-uninitialized]
>>> 2789 1772 | if (ret) {
>>> 2790 | ^
>>
>>
>> The routine to fix is vfio_devices_start_dirty_page_tracking(). The compiler
>> is doing some inlining.
>>
> I don't think I understand how inlining could cause it.
> Could you elaborate on this?
The compiler reports an error in routine 'vfio_listener_log_global_start'
but the fix should be in 'vfio_devices_start_dirty_page_tracking'. Surely
because the compiler optimization inlines the latter.
>
> I thought that the compiler just missed the initialization of ret because it happens in the if else statement, and that simply doing "int ret = 0;" would solve it.
Yes. This will work.
